How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 65802?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 65802 Studio Apartments | $1,018 | $575 | $2,499 |
| 65802 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,016 | $505 | $3,000 |
| 65802 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,149 | $575 | $3,751 |
| 65802 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,549 | $609 | $4,299 |
| 65802 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,788 | $550 | $10,118 |
